IT Data & Analytics Strategy Lead

Company

Ipsen Biopharm Ltd

Job Description

Summary / purpose of the position

The Data Value Office (DVO) is a newly established unit in Global IT acting as the counterpart for business functions which is led by the Chief Data Officer (CDO). The focus of the Data Value Office is to detail and execute Ipsen’s Global Data Strategy and Analytics Strategy to unlock the full potential of data across all functions.

Therefore, the Data Value Office is responsible to develop a Global Data & Analytics Operating Model, a Global Data Governance framework to support functions with the implementation of data governance as well as enabling Data Management and Analytics capabilities.

The Data & Analytics Strategy Lead acts on behalf of the Chief Data Officer to advise and guide on the design of the Data and Analytics Strategy supporting the overall digital transformation journey.

Therefore, we are looking for a Data & Analytics Strategy Lead working at the enterprise level who has a strong strategic mindset, deep experience in change management up to C-level and brings a broad knowledge about all functions of a pharmaceutical company to drive the change, translate business requirements into data & analytics requirements and drive the implementation of the data governance framework across the organization in delegation of the Chief Data Officer.

Main Responsibilities / Job Expectations

Responsible to drive the design of the global data & analytics strategy and roadmap
  • Translating use cases into technical, skill and process requirements and derive the overall data and analytics strategy
  • Defining the overall data governance strategy across all data domains linked to broader business priorities and regulatory requirements
  • Developing the data and analytics roadmap with a focus on value generation and ensuring continuous update
  • Identifying required data governance tools as well as driving the implementation including design of required processes, roles and responsibilities and potential charge back models
  • Designing and implementing standard templates across the organization
  • Continuously gathering feedback, updating the strategies and frameworks, and aligning changes across data domains
Responsible to drive the change and foster data culture and literacy across the organization
  • Detailing communication plan and designing communication material
  • Actively driving the change across all hierarchy levels (up to C-level) including communications and training to foster overall data culture and literacy and ensure that the organization understands that data should be treated as an asset
  • Developing a training concept around analytics and data, preparing, and facilitating trainings across all hierarchy levels
Responsible to facilitate data governance globally
  • Defining data governance KPI’s and aligning these with data governance roles across data domains to ensure continuous tracking
  • Generating insights around data quality and deriving mitigation plan
  • Acting as the “go to person” for all data governance leads to support individual data domain governance
  • Facilitation of key data governance bodies
